Introduction to AI Development Platforms
AI development platforms are software frameworks designed to assist developers in creating, testing, and deploying AI applications. These platforms offer various tools and services, including data processing, model training, and model deployment. Some of the best AI development platforms include;
1. TensorFlow;
TensorFlow is an open-source AI development platform developed by Google. It is one of the most sought-after AI platforms developers use due to its ease of use and versatility. TensorFlow supports multiple programming languages, making it accessible to many developers. It offers various tools and services for building, training, and deploying machine learning models.
2. Keras;
A high-level neural network API called Keras was created to make it easier to develop deep learning models.
It is built on TensorFlow and provides an easy-to-use interface for creating complex deep-learning models.
With simply a few lines of code, Keras enables developers to create and train models using a variety of neural network designs.
3. PyTorch;
PyTorch is another open-source AI development platform that has recently gained popularity. It is widely used in research and academic circles due to its flexibility and ease of use. PyTorch provides a Python-based interface allowing developers to build and train deep learning models quickly. It also offers various tools and services for deploying models in production environments.
4. Microsoft Azure;
Microsoft Azure is a platform for developing AI applications in the cloud that provides various tools and services for creating, evaluating, and deploying AI solutions. It provides a user-friendly interface that allows developers to create and manage machine learning models without extensive coding knowledge. Microsoft Azure also offers a wide range of pre-built models and APIs that can be used to develop AI applications quickly.
5. IBM Watson Studio;
IBM Watson Studio is an AI development platform that provides a wide range of tools and services for building, testing, and deploying AI applications. It offers a user-friendly interface allowing developers to create and manage machine learning models quickly. IBM Watson Studio also provides a wide range of pre-built models and APIs that can be used to develop AI applications rapidly.
6. H2O.ai;
H2O.ai is an open-source AI development platform that provides many tools and services for building, testing, and deploying machine learning models. Because it supports numerous programming languages, including Python, R, and Java, it is usable by many developers. Additionally, H2O.ai offers developers a user-friendly interface that makes it simple to design and manage machine learning models.
